Integrated protective magnetic suspension motor and magnetic suspension vacuum pump
Through integrated protection design and self-circulating cooling system, the problems of weak sealing and insufficient heat dissipation of magnetic levitation vacuum pumps are solved, achieving high protection level and efficient heat dissipation, which is suitable for semiconductor, photovoltaic, papermaking and chemical industries.

TECHNICAL FIELD
[0001] The application relates to a magnetic suspension motor and a magnetic suspension vacuum pump with integrated protection. BACKGROUND
[0002] The magnetic suspension vacuum pump realizes contactless suspension of a rotating shaft by using a magnetic suspension bearing, has the advantages of no oil pollution, high rotating speed, low vibration and noise, and is widely applied to the fields of semiconductors, photovoltaics, papermaking and chemical industry.
[0003] The magnetic suspension motor, as the core of the magnetic suspension vacuum pump, mainly comprises a rotating shaft, a stator, a front radial magnetic bearing, a rear radial magnetic bearing and an axial magnetic bearing, and front and rear protective bearings for protection, and the bearings need to be accurately and stably installed and positioned, and the installation design of the bearing seats is crucial.
[0004] In the existing design of the magnetic suspension vacuum pump, the bearing seats are usually manufactured as independent components and then are respectively installed on the shell structure of the pump by means of bolt connection. The assembly interfaces between the multiple independent bearing seats and the shell and between the bearing seats form a large number of complex joints and connecting surfaces. These positions are weak links of sealing, and it is difficult to prevent dust, water vapor, oil mist and even corrosive gas from invading the inside of the vacuum pump cavity through the gaps. This seriously restricts the improvement of the protection grade (such as IP54, IP65, etc.) of the magnetic suspension vacuum pump and limits the application of the magnetic suspension vacuum pump in harsh industrial environments such as humidity, dust and corrosive atmosphere. In addition, in the existing design, multiple heat dissipation channels or openings are often provided on the bearing seats for better heat dissipation, but this conflicts with the requirement of improving the sealing and protection grade, so that the design optimization space for realizing high-efficiency heat dissipation under the premise of high protection grade is limited.
[0005] Therefore, an improved magnetic suspension vacuum pump is urgently needed to significantly improve the protection grade and overall heat dissipation problem. SUMMARY
[0006] In view of the deficiencies of the prior art, the application provides a magnetic suspension motor with integrated protection, which installs a front protective bearing seat, a front radial magnetic bearing seat, a rear protective bearing seat and a rear radial magnetic bearing seat in the inside of a shell, so as to avoid the joints and connecting surfaces between the bearing seats from being exposed to the outside. A single air inlet and a single air outlet are adopted to reduce the leakage points and realize protection above IP54, which is superior to the traditional multi-air-port motor. Meanwhile, a heat dissipation impeller is arranged in the magnetic suspension motor to utilize negative pressure to guide cooling air to the inside of the motor for sufficient heat dissipation.

[0040] The present embodiment provides a kind of integrated protection magnetic suspension motor, as shown in Figure 1 And Figure 6 As shown, it includes shell 1, the front end of shell 1 is provided with front backboard 13, the rear end of shell 1 is provided with tail end sealing element, tail end sealing element can include tail end cover 2 and tail end cover 3, tail end cover 2 is fixed on shell 1, tail end cover 3 is fixed on tail end cover 2, shell 1, front backboard 13, tail end cover 2 and tail end cover 3 form installation cavity,
[0041] Only one air inlet 4 and one air outlet 19 are provided on shell 1,
[0042] In installation cavity, the inside of stator 8 is sleeved with rotating shaft 9, the front end of stator 8 is sleeved from inside to outside and is provided with front radial magnetic bearing seat 15 and front protection bearing seat 14, the inside of front radial magnetic bearing seat 15 and front protection bearing seat 14 is respectively installed with front radial magnetic bearing 16 and front protection bearing;Front protection bearing is not marked in the drawing.
[0043] The rear end of stator 8 is provided with rear radial magnetic bearing seat 6 and rear protection bearing seat 29 from inside to outside, the inside of rear radial magnetic bearing seat 6 is installed with rear radial magnetic bearing 17 and axial magnetic bearing 18, here rear radial magnetic bearing seat 6 adopts integrated design;The inside of rear protection bearing seat 29 is provided with rear protection bearing;
[0044] The rear end of rotating shaft 9 is installed with heat dissipation impeller 10, and heat dissipation impeller 10 is located on the rear side of rear protection bearing seat 29 along the axial direction of rotating shaft, and flow guide cover 22 is further provided outside heat dissipation impeller 10;Under the action of negative pressure, cooling air enters installation cavity from air inlet 4, passes through heat dissipation impeller 10, first cooling air duct 30, stator 8 and rotating shaft 9, and then is transmitted to the other side of motor, carries away the heat of each component, and finally is discharged from air outlet 19, to realize the cooling of the inside of motor.
[0045] The front radial magnetic bearing seat 15, the front protective bearing seat 14, the rear radial magnetic bearing seat 6 and the rear protective bearing seat 29 are arranged inside the mounting cavity, and only one air inlet 4 and one air outlet 19 are arranged on the shell 1, so that the core components of the motor can be better protected, and the protection level of the magnetic suspension motor is improved.
[0046] In one example embodiment, as shown in Figure 1 The front radial magnetic bearing seat 15 is fixed inside the shell 1, the front protective bearing seat 14 is fixed outside the front radial magnetic bearing seat 15, and the front protective bearing seat 14 is nested inside the front back plate 13, and the front back plate 13 radially covers the outside of the front protective bearing seat 14.
[0047] In the existing design, the front back plate 13 and the front protective bearing seat 14 are designed to be separated front and rear and are sequentially fitted on the rotating shaft 9, but this increases the length of the rotating shaft 9 and the complexity of installation. Alternatively, the front back plate 13 and the front protective bearing seat 14 are designed to be integrated into an integrated back plate, which can shorten the size of the rotating shaft 9, but the radius of the integrated back plate is too large and can easily deform during operation, affecting the protection function of the front protective bearing. In the present application, the front radial magnetic bearing seat 15 and the front back plate 13 are designed to be nested inside and outside, which not only reduces the length of the rotating shaft 9, but also ensures that the front back plate 13 does not deform and the front protective bearing functions.
[0048] In one example embodiment, as shown in Figure 4 The face of the front back plate 13 facing the outside of the mounting cavity is provided with a plurality of sealing grooves 21, and the face of the front back plate 13 close to the front protective bearing seat 14 is provided with a sealing groove 21. In the magnetic suspension motor related equipment, the sealing groove 21 can prevent the air at the front end of the motor from leaking into the mounting cavity through the gap between the front back plate 13 and the front protective bearing seat 14.
[0049] In one example embodiment, as shown in Figure 2 and Figure 3 The face of the front protective bearing seat 14 facing the outside of the mounting cavity is provided with a plurality of sealing grooves 21, and a plurality of first ventilation holes 20 are formed in the side wall of the front protective bearing seat 14 surrounding the rotating shaft 9. After the air entering through the air inlet 4 is cooled by other components, it finally enters the space surrounded by the outer wall of the shell 1, the front protective bearing seat 14 and the front radial magnetic bearing 16 through the first ventilation hole 20, and is finally discharged through the air outlet 19. The first ventilation hole 20 in the side wall of the front protective bearing seat 14 guides the airflow to flow evenly through the bearing area, which is conducive to eliminating local overheating and improving temperature uniformity.
[0050] In one example embodiment, as shown in Figure 1As shown, the rear radial magnetic bearing seat 6 is fixed inside the casing 1, the rear protective bearing seat 29 and the fairing 22 are both fixed outside the rear radial magnetic bearing seat 6, and the first cooling air channel 30 is formed between the rear protective bearing seat 29 and the fairing 22. The cooling air output by the heat dissipation impeller 10 passes through the first cooling air channel 30, the rear protective bearing seat 29, the axial magnetic bearing 18, the rear radial magnetic bearing 17, or passes through the first cooling air channel, the rear radial magnetic bearing seat 6, and then reaches the space where the stator 8 wire package is located.
[0051] In an exemplary embodiment, as shown in Figure 1 The magnetic levitation motor further comprises an intercooler, and the intercooler is fixed at the lower part of the casing 1, so that the air inlet 4 and the air outlet 19 on the casing 1 are in communication with the air outlet and the air inlet of the intercooler, respectively. In order to ensure sufficient heat dissipation of the motor interior, the gas enters the casing 1 through the air inlet 4, carries away the heat of the motor interior, enters the intercooler through the air outlet 19 on the casing 1, is sufficiently cooled in the intercooler, and then enters through the air inlet 4 on the casing 1, and so on, so as to ensure the heat dissipation effect of the motor interior. The intercooler is not marked in the drawings.
[0052] In an exemplary embodiment, as shown in Figure 1 The casing 1 is further provided with a water channel 31, so as to ensure sufficient heat dissipation of the stator 8.
[0053] The working process of the magnetic levitation motor is as follows: the motor is started, the shaft 9 drives the tail heat dissipation impeller 10 to rotate, and under the action of negative pressure, the cooling air in the intercooler enters the installation cavity through the air inlet 4 and enters the air inlet 5 of the heat dissipation impeller 10, and is compressed by the heat dissipation impeller 10; the compressed cooling air is divided into two paths to dissipate heat in the motor interior, a part of the cooling air passes through the heat dissipation holes on the rear radial magnetic bearing seat 6, and then enters the space where the stator 8 wire package is located; the other part of the cooling air passes through the heat dissipation holes on the rear protective bearing seat 29, the axial magnetic bearing 18, and the rear radial magnetic bearing 17, and then enters the space where the stator 8 wire package is located.
[0054] The cooling air carries away the heat of the stator 8 and the shaft 9 through the gap between the shaft 9 and the stator 8, then passes through the first air vent 20 on the front protective bearing seat 14, the cavity formed between the front radial magnetic bearing seat 15 and the casing 1, and the second cooling air channel 23 provided on the casing 1, and finally returns to the intercooler through the air outlet 19 on the casing 1, thereby completing the cooling cycle of the motor by the first cooling air. The second cooling air channel 23 is in communication with the air outlet 19.
[0055] On the other hand, the present application provides a magnetic levitation vacuum pump, as shown in Figure 5 and Figure 7As shown, including the above-mentioned magnetic suspension motor, and the front end of the rotating shaft 9 is installed with the working impeller 11, the outside of the working impeller 11 is sleeved with the volute 12, the volute 12 is directly fixed on the casing 1, and the outside of the volute 12 is provided with the current collector 7.
[0056] The radial magnetic bearing seat is fixed in the inside of the casing 1, and the volute 12 is also fixed on the casing 1, so that the front radial magnetic bearing seat 15 and the volute 12 are both referenced to the casing 1, which can better guarantee the coaxiality of the volute 12 and the front radial magnetic bearing stator; and the mass of the volute 12 is larger, and the volute 12 is fixed on the casing 1, which can avoid the extrusion deformation of the volute 12 to the front protection bearing seat 14, so that the front protection bearing can better play a protection role on the rotating shaft 9.
[0057] In an example embodiment, as shown in Figure 7 and Figure 8 As shown, the magnetic suspension vacuum pump is also provided with an equalizing mechanism, the equalizing mechanism includes equalizing holes 27, an equalizing cavity, gas guide holes 24 and an equalizing channel 28; a plurality of equalizing holes 27 are arranged on the front back plate 13, the inside of the front back plate 13 is provided with an equalizing plate 26, the equalizing plate 26 and the front back plate 13 surround to form an equalizing cavity, the equalizing plate 26 is provided with gas guide holes 24, and the casing is also provided with an equalizing channel 28, both ends of the equalizing channel 28 are respectively communicated with the gas guide holes 24 and the current collector 7. When the magnetic suspension vacuum pump works, the small end of the working impeller 11 is negative pressure, which can attract the rotating shaft to deviate towards the volute, and the equalizing channel 28 is communicated with the current collector 7, and under the negative pressure of the current collector 7, the front and back of the working impeller 11 are equalized, which reduces the axial deviation of the rotating shaft 9 to the volute 12.
[0058] In an example embodiment, as shown in Figure 8 The equalizing channel 28 is provided with an equalizing pipe 25 at the gas outlet, and the other end of the equalizing pipe 25 is communicated with the current collector 7. The equalizing pipe 25 is fixed on the outside of the casing and plays a role of guiding flow.
